The LastPass Scandal and Its Lessons

In 2022, LastPass suffered a massive data breach: password vaults of millions of users were stolen. The event showed how critical the choice of password manager is.

Why European Password Managers?

European providers are subject to GDPR and strict data protection laws. They cannot be forced by US authorities to hand over data via the Cloud Act.

The Best European Alternatives

Bitwarden (USA/EU Servers, Open Source)

Although Bitwarden comes from the US, the code is fully open source and can be self-hosted. EU servers are available.

Advantages:

  • Fully open source – anyone can review the code
  • Free tier with all basic features
  • Self-hosting possible
  • Browser extensions for all major browsers
  • End-to-end encryption

Proton Pass (Switzerland)

From the makers of Proton Mail comes Proton Pass – a full-featured password manager with Swiss data protection.

Advantages:

  • Swiss data protection laws
  • Integrated into the Proton ecosystem
  • End-to-end encrypted
  • Alias email addresses included

Vaultwarden (Self-Hosted)

Vaultwarden is a lightweight, Bitwarden-compatible server implementation for maximum control.

Security Tips for Password Managers

1. Master password: At least 20 characters, randomly generated

2. Two-factor authentication: Always enable

3. Regular backups: Export the vault regularly

4. Uniqueness: A unique password for every service
